Apartment to rent.

A spacious 150 sqm apartment in Jardins with a commercial gym right in front! This is an excellent option for those looking for both space and amenities (given the proximity of the gym in front) in an incredible Jardins location!

Real wood floors, modern concrete finishings, a spacious kitchen and two Queen bedrooms (the Master is an en suite with walk-in-closet) are all excellent reasons to make this your new home!

High end shops and delightful restaurants are the day to day advantages of living in Jardins! However as it's name indicates the greener environment is also a huge draw! The dream of a "garden district" came from England to Brazil in the nineteenth century with the English urbanist Barry Parker. The houses were constructed to allow for expansive green spaces between them. In the 50s, the area was inundated with luxurious buildings, according to the needs of the Paulista elite of the time. The neighbourhood has since become one with the highest concentration of opulence and glamour of São Paulo.



The region consists of four gardens: Jardim Europa, Jardim America, Jardim Paulista and Jardim Paulistano. Nonetheless, it's not only extravagant buildings and upscale houses that are found in the region. The Gardens are also home to the luxury motoring market. More than often, entire streets are lined with Lamborghini and Ferrari super-cars, so it's not uncommon to see the world's best machines roaming the region's avenues. Jardins is also known for having a street that combines the best of the fashion world, Rua Oscar Freire. Within a few blocks you can find stores like Iódice and H. Stern. And if you get hungry whilst shopping, you can indulge in some of the area's trendiest restaurants, like Antiquarius, and Dulca - a restaurant that specialises in the craft of sweetmeat.
